About Jeannette

Jeannette Mason is a psychotherapeutic counsellor who uses an integrative, person-focused approach. She draws on attachment work, mindfulness and trauma-informed ideas to help people manage stress and anxiety. Jeannette holds BACP membership and combines talking and body-based methods to address how distress shows up in daily life.

She supports people struggling with anxiety, depression, grief and life changes. She also works with those coping with trauma, relationship difficulties, sleep problems, low self-esteem and the pressures of parenting or caring.

Background and approach

ADHD, bipolar mood concerns and compassion fatigue are also within her areas of focus. Her practice mixes short-term problem solving and longer conversations about patterns that repeat over time. Jeannette uses Solution-Focused Therapy to set practical goals and Mindfulness and Somatic approaches to help regulate emotion and notice bodily signals.

Trauma-Focused and Attachment-Based perspectives help when early wounds shape current relationships. Jeannette trained in Transactional Analysis and integrative psychotherapy at postgraduate level. She previously worked in general nursing, and that background shapes a practical, health-aware outlook in sessions.

Her BACP membership is listed as BACP. She aims for a warm, interactive style and works with each client to build a tailored plan. The first session is a chance to agree aims, try a way of working and see if the approach feels like a good fit.

Approaches you can use online

Jeannette uses Attachment-Based Therapy to look at how early relationships shape current patterns. This approach helps when trust, closeness or fear of abandonment affect everyday life. Mindfulness Therapy is used to teach simple attention and breathing practices that reduce anxiety and improve sleep. These skills can be practised between sessions and help people feel steadier. Solution-Focused Therapy focuses on small, practical steps and clear goals to create change faster and tackle immediate stresses.

Choosing the right approach is part of the work together. Jeannette will discuss your needs, goals and preferences and then try methods that fit. That collaborative process means the plan can change as progress is made and new priorities appear.

Online sessions are offered by video call, phone, live chat or text-based messaging. Video calls allow face-to-face conversation and visual cues, while phone sessions can be easier when bandwidth is limited or you prefer not to be on camera. Live chat and messaging are useful for brief check-ins, homework support or when a shorter contact fits your day. These options make it simpler to fit therapy around work, family and travel commitments, and let people keep continuity of care when moving between locations.
